Certainly. There is also a performance penalty to unbounded row
sizes. That penalty is your nodes OOMing. I strongly recommend you
abandon that direction.

On 7/31/10 3:42 PM, Benjamin Black wrote:
The proper way to handle this is to have a row per time interval such
that
The proper way to handle this is to have a row per time interval such
that the number of columns per row is constrained.
